Since I rebuilt the engine on my 4.0 P38, there was a leak on the rad.

I picked a second hand one up this morning, and low and behold.....it's ****ing out.

I feel that having done all the work I've done on the car, I know it inside out....certainly a simple radiator connection, but I'm starting to doubt my sanity......so

Top hose, connected and tight, no leaks.

Bleed hose, connected and tight, no leaks.

Bottom hoses and stat housing, all connected and tight, no leaks.

Drain plug, tight and no leaks.

Both rad's have dripped from the right hand side as you look at the car.........I'm assuming both the existing and the salvage rad are fooked?......or am I missing something?
 
when bolting in the rad everyting must be slackened first.ive known them twist before resulting in leaking when 2 bottom bolts are tightened up and yes always from the bottom where the plastic is crimped to the alloy.work in reversall its worth a try
